Apply for Full-time Tenure-Track Faculty - Nursing
Department: Health Sciences
Teaching Nursing courses in class and clinical settings for courses spanning the Associate Degree Nursing Curriculum.
Minimum Requirements Include:
- Master’s Degree in Nursing (MSN) including graduate level nursing education and curriculum courses.
- Current non-encumbered Commonwealth of Pennsylvania RN License.
- Current CPR
- Clear criminal record check; no DUI; child abuse free in lifetime
- Minimum of three years’ relevant Medical/Surgical clinical nursing patient care experience
- Demonstrated ability to clinically supervise students in adult medical-surgical setting, as well as a variety of other settings and specialty areas.
- (Preferred Qualification) Clinical nursing/patient care experiences, for patients across the lifespan, in a diverse range of inpatient and outpatient care areas.
- (Preferred Qualification) Didactic/lab experience facilitating learning in higher education; knowledge of the applications of instructional technology; experience with community college students, and curriculum development and pedagogy.
- (Preferred Qualification) Willingness to teach in any modality (face-to-face, hybrid, eLearning, multi-campus with synchronous web conferencing) and to consider the adoption of open educational resources rather than commercial textbooks.
